Overcoming Obstacles in the Way of Aspirations
ByWe all have our aspirations listed in our hearts. Some of the brave ones among us actually do something in order to reach those aspirations, while most others simply sit back and try finding a way of not to do it. It is good to dream. Without dreams there would be no hopes. Without hopes we would not aspire. And without aspirations there would be no accomplishments.
However, it is important to work towards these aspirations. Otherwise they are useless. The most common deterrent to an aspiration is fear. If you fear the difficulty associated with the task of accomplishing it then you have lost before you have started. Although a trial and error method might take time to reap benefits, it is the best way to start off.
Don’t push back the schedule everyday. Procrastination kills the most solid dreams in people. If you don’t feel like doing something today, and you think you will want to do it tomorrow, you should know that you won’t feel like doing it tomorrow either. And in the end, you will never end up doing it. Therefore, do what needs to be done right now.
Don’t be pessimistic about the results of your work. It is not always necessary to win. But if you do not try at all, you will have failed for sure. Since the probability is the same in case of doing and not doing something, you might as well do it and face your fears and give yourself the chance to succeed.
Sometimes fear has the ability to make people do things they never thought they could. But other than the initial push, fear does not have the tenacity to make you keep going at it in case of failure. In order to conquer fear you need to continue trying till you succeed. Be courageous and take examples of people who never gave up.
Sometimes you are not enough to make you do something. Therefore, take help from family and friends who will push you hard enough to make you put in effort to accomplish tasks that you have been procrastinating for a long time.
Sometimes when the path to a goal is too long we tend to lose focus and interest in it. Therefore, we have the tendency to give up before reaching the end. However, the trick to overcome this is to look at the path from a different point of view. It also helps when you talk to others who might be able to show you a fresh reason as to why you should continue doing it.
If you are constantly thinking of reasons as to why you will fail in the task at hand, think of the reasons as to why you will succeed in it simultaneously. Say both of them out loud one after another and hear them yourself.
Every goal has hurdles before it to be overcome. Motivation and hard work gets you to the end most of the time.
